Description

Add a section in [1] to explain the configuration when there is a cluster fronted by a LB
When there is a LB, add the LB DNS as the call back url.

This callback url is taken from the server.hostname in deployment.toml file. Therefore if its a APIM cluster then better to put the LB DNS under server.hostname
